> > If someone will mess up the environment, it is possible to clear it by
> > holding a button upon powerup. Atm i have the CONFIG_ETH_ADDR set to a
> > default MAC address to be able to use the network console with the
> > default environment. To restore the original MAC address, a user have to
> > manually replace ethaddr with the one printed on the case.
> > 
> > But now, if i can't use the CONFIG_ETH_ADDR, i think i'm stuck :) Or do i
> > miss something? (Yeah there may be the MAC randomization, if accepted).
> 
> There are more clever ways than just to clear the environment. We have
> "env export" and "env import", so you can create one or more backup
> copies or user proviles.  Instead of clearing the environment, you
> could also load one such previously saved user profile, which then
> would contain the MAC address.

thanks for the hint, but there is only 512kb flash on this board (with 64k 
sectors). I don't think there is enough room for a second copy of the 
environment.

and in some way, the mac address has to find its way into one of these 
environments.

i think there are more boards like this, esp. since there is this mac 
randomization code within the mvgbe driver.
